My 1955 Plymouth with Powerflite developed a major trans leak today.
While I was driving the car it suddenly slowed down like the brake had
been applied even though it was not. After a few seconds the car was fine
again. When I returned home about a mile later a noticed a whining noise
that was not previously there. Upon inspection under the car I found trans
fluid dripping rapidly(about a drop a second) from the torque converter
housing. I later got under the vehicle and removed the access cover for
the torque converter drain plug and saw that the fluid was coming from
between the torque converter and trans. I know this could be the front
seal on the trans but that does not explain the whining noise I hear when
the engine is idling. Has anyone else experienced this problem or have any
ideas as to what might have gone wrong? Thanks for any help in advance.
